Thanks for reaching out Jaime, and I appreciate you providing a screenshot of your concern. I can imagine how important it is to receive timely and effective support when you need it. Don't worry, I'm here to ensure we'll get this sorted out.

 

It seems like you may have some browser issues going on, such as bad cache. Web browsers collect cache to save time when loading repetitive data and images. Over time, these files can become outdated and corrupted, causing issues like the one with your weekly timesheets not working. Allow me to provide some troubleshooting steps to rectify this.

 

Let's start by logging into your QuickBooks account using an incognito window. You can also use other supported browsers to learn what browsers need for the best experience when using QuickBooks. You can use these shortcut keys to access a private window:

 

  • Mozilla Firefox: CTRL + Shift + P
  • Microsoft Edge: CTRL + Shift + N
  • Google Chrome: CTRL + Shift + N
  • Safari: Command + Shift + N

 

After signing in, click on weekly time again to see if it opens. If it works, go back to your regular browser and clear its cache.

Hi Nicole, thank you for your response. I was on the phone with a representative, and they gave the same solution. It's not the cache because it's happening to multiple users, not just my account; if it was just my account that was the issue, the cache and cookies could potentially be a solution, but not when it's across multiple users since the cache is individual to each computer.

 

Just to be sure, we cleared the cache and browsing history- still the same loading error. We tried logging in on multiple browsers (regular and incognito/private mode) and are still having the same issue.
